Smike MBTI & Enneagram | Nicholas Nickleby

MBTI Type: ISFJ

Smike seems to live his life entirely for others, throughout much of the story. He has never known anything but unkindness before Nicholas comes to the school and shows him tenderness, but that allows him to believe there might be some good in the world worth searching for. He does everything he is told, and is ‘worked half to death,’ but only runs away after Nicholas promises him that “we might meet out there in the world.” After that, after Nicholas rescues him, he spends all of his time utterly devoted to his new friend, in which he has found “a home.” His sweetness, goodness, and generosity of spirit make him likable to everyone who meets him, and he desperately wants to please them all. Even though he struggles to get out his words at the play, it emboldens and cheers him to have others applaud and encourage him, showing his Fe’s deep need for acceptance, kindness, and affirmation. Even though he endures much hardship, he never has an unkind word for anyone, and rather freely talks about his feelings even though he is shy. But he does not want Kate to know how much he loves her, and asks Nicholas to conceal the lock of her hair from her, but also bury it close to his heart after he dies. Smike has no real dreams for himself, although he does wonder why bad things have happened to him. He shows a low Ne’s innocent hope for the future, once he knows it can contain more than he ever imagined it would.

Enneagram: 9w1 so/sp

Smike has learned to survive by doing whatever he is told, and not making a fuss, but he is easily hurt by cruelties, and is looking for someone to save and protect him. He tries to get by, by making himself small and doing whatever is required of him, in an attempt to remain invisible and deflect any potential abuse. He becomes devoted to Nicholas once the young man stands up for him, and follows his example in finding his courage. Nicholas says of him that he is a sweet, tender-hearted soul, who might have ‘healed his father’s cruel heart,’ if he had been allowed to love him. Everyone loves Smike for being so gentle and compassionate, for forgiving even when it isn’t due, and for wanting for very little in life. He has no great ambitions of his own, merely the desire to be with the ones he loves and to do what is right. Smike doesn’t want to cause a fuss or inconvenience anyone, but also tends to take on the traits of whomever he is around—he wants to merge into Nicholas and take refuge in his strength, and inspired by him, attempts to run away to find his freedom. Despite his awful situation, Smike has managed to remain kind, good-hearted, and happy.
